Asparagus fern is one of the most popular foliage plants. It looks green and attractive, with thin stems and branches, but it is upright and strong. Its leaves are mostly cloud-like, layered, and have a high ornamental value. Many people like to grow it indoors. However, when some people grow asparagus fern, they often encounter undesirable conditions such as yellow leaves and withered branches. What's going on? Next, the editor will talk about it in detail, and will write down all the cultivation methods and precautions for asparagus fern. Cultivation methods and precautions of asparagus fern1. Reasonable watering and fertilization During the cultivation period, water and fertilizer should be properly controlled for asparagus fern. Although it likes moisture, it is afraid of waterlogging in the pot soil. If it is watered too much, the roots of asparagus fern will rot. Therefore, it is necessary to water it less in the cooler weather or in winter. In addition, asparagus fern also has certain requirements for fertilizer. It should be top-dressed once every half a month during the growth season, and fertilization should be stopped after entering winter. 2. Requirements of Asparagus fern for light The asparagus fern plant likes to grow in a shady and humid environment and cannot be placed under direct sunlight, especially in the hot summer. It is necessary to provide the asparagus fern with necessary shade, otherwise its leaves will dry up, and in severe cases it may even die due to excessive water loss. 3. Pay attention to keeping asparagus fern warm The plant asparagus fern has very poor cold resistance and likes a warm environment. It will die when the outside temperature is below ten degrees in winter. If the indoor conditions for the growth of asparagus fern are not met, you can put a plastic bag on the surface of the asparagus fern to keep it warm. However, the plastic bag should be removed during the day to allow it to be exposed to sunlight, otherwise it will be extremely detrimental to the growth of asparagus fern. |
